S. R. Mortimer is a scholar working on Nature and Landscape Conservation, Ecology, Evolution, Behavior and Systematics and Plant Science. According to data from OpenAlex, S. R. Mortimer has authored 18 papers receiving a total of 804 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Nature and Landscape Conservation, 7 papers in Ecology, Evolution, Behavior and Systematics and 6 papers in Plant Science. Recurrent topics in S. R. Mortimer’s work include Ecology and Vegetation Dynamics Studies (8 papers), Plant and animal studies (6 papers) and Land Use and Ecosystem Services (4 papers). S. R. Mortimer is often cited by papers focused on Ecology and Vegetation Dynamics Studies (8 papers), Plant and animal studies (6 papers) and Land Use and Ecosystem Services (4 papers). S. R. Mortimer collaborates with scholars based in United Kingdom, The Netherlands and Sweden. S. R. Mortimer's co-authors include Wim H. van der Putten, V. K. Brown, Katarina Hedlund, Petr Šmilauer, Sandra Lavorel, C. Van Dijk, Dagmar Gormsen, Jacques Roy, I. Santa Regina and G.W. Korthals and has published in prestigious journals such as Oecologia, Trends in Food Science & Technology and Biological Conservation.
